A former CEO has been charged with embezzling more than $15 million from her employer and using stolen money to pay for a lavish lifestyle, including travel, jewelry and family weddings, according to federal prosecutors.Donna Osowitt Steele, of Taylorsville, North Carolina, also used stolen money to fund personal businesses run by her family, according to a court filing Friday by U.S. Attorney Dena Kings office.Steele is charged with one count of wire fraud. She allegedly charged approximately $255,000 for stays at the Plaza Hotel in New York City, more than $500,000 for jewelry, over $200,000 for family wedding expenses and more than $100,000 for flowers.Steele also transferred more than $350,000 in embezzled money to a high-end clothing and furniture business that she operated called Opulence by Steele, according to the court filing. For example, filed court documents show that Steele used company credit cards to pay for $6 million in personal expenditures, including to make high-end retail store purchases, to pay for luxury hotel accommodations and event ticket purchases, to buy expensive jewelry, to pay for family weddings, and to make purchases related to Opulence by Steele, a luxury clothing and boutique company the defendant founded in 2013. Furthermore, Steele caused 127 fraudulent and unauthorized wire transfers to be executed as Quickbooks transactions, transferring more than $4.7 million from Tigra USAs bank accounts to her personal bank account. Osowitt worked at Tigra USA Inc. in Hickory, CEO/president Bernd Motzer confirmed Saturday. According to filed plea documents and admissions made by Steele in court, from at least 2013 to January 2020, the defendant executed an extensive scheme to defraud her employer, identified in court documents as Tigra USA, a privately held U.S. based subsidiary of a foreign company that manufactures carbide products. 5 Stars (2) Reviews. Initially, Steele worked in the shipping department and was promoted over the next 20 years to various positions within the company, including to the position of Chief Executive Officer (CEO), which she held until she was terminated in January 2020. Court records show that Steele embezzled over $15 million from Victim Company A and used the money to support a business run by her and her family and to fund an extravagant lifestyle. According to filed documents, as a result of Steeles embezzlement, Victim Company A experienced several difficulties, including vendors withholding products from the company for non-payment or late payments, customers complaining about being placed on credit holds, notwithstanding timely payments of their bills, employees having their company credit cards declined when they were trying to use them for legitimate business expenses, employees not being paid on time, and/or employees having their insurance cancelled without warning.
